Every year before Easter (which is 27th of April this time) we usually go to the cemeteries to clean, paint and set in flowers...

It takes 45 minutes by bus and the same amount of time walking through the forest to get to my grandma's burial site.
Tiring and relaxing at the same time.

Cemetery in my country is some sacred place where you can't talk loud or laugh.

A fresh grave


I remember being kids, me and my cousin always wanted to play there, every grave sight seemed like a toy playhouse but it was prohibited.
So while adults were busy we've been cleaning abandoned graves and were proud of ourselves, feeling useful, like those whose bones rest under the ground would appreciate our efforts and good intentions.
